Pancasila, the five principles that form the foundation of Indonesia's national identity, plays a crucial role in shaping the country's economic system. Among these principles, the second sila, "Kemanusiaan yang Adil dan Beradab" (Just and Civilized Humanity), holds significant influence on the economic landscape of Indonesia. This sila emphasizes the importance of human dignity, social justice, and equitable distribution of wealth, guiding the nation towards a more inclusive and sustainable economic model.

The Essence of Pancasila Sila Kedua in Economic Context

The second sila of Pancasila underscores the inherent value of every human being and advocates for a society that prioritizes fairness and compassion. In the economic sphere, this translates into a commitment to ensuring that the benefits of economic growth are shared equitably among all members of society. This principle rejects the notion of unchecked capitalism, where the pursuit of profit often overshadows the well-being of individuals and communities. Instead, it promotes a system that prioritizes the needs of the people, particularly the most vulnerable segments of society.

Fostering Economic Equality and Social Justice

Pancasila Sila Kedua serves as a guiding principle for promoting economic equality and social justice in Indonesia. It emphasizes the need to bridge the gap between the rich and the poor, ensuring that everyone has access to basic necessities and opportunities for advancement. This principle is reflected in various government policies aimed at reducing poverty, improving access to education and healthcare, and creating a more equitable distribution of wealth.

Promoting Inclusive Economic Growth

The second sila of Pancasila advocates for an economic system that is inclusive and benefits all segments of society. This means prioritizing the development of rural areas, empowering small and medium enterprises, and creating employment opportunities for all. By fostering an inclusive economic environment, Indonesia aims to reduce regional disparities and ensure that the benefits of economic growth reach all corners of the country.

Embracing Sustainable Economic Practices

Pancasila Sila Kedua also emphasizes the importance of sustainable economic practices that prioritize the well-being of future generations. This principle encourages responsible resource management, environmental protection, and the promotion of ethical business practices. By embracing sustainability, Indonesia aims to create a more resilient and equitable economic system that can withstand the challenges of the 21st century.
